""(Historical Documents Institut Francais De Washington)"" is a significant scholarly collection dedicated to the preservation and analysis of the diplomatic and cultural ties between France and the United States. Edited by the distinguished historian Elizabeth S. Kite, this volume compiles essential primary source materials that document the intricate relationship between these two nations during the late eighteenth century.

Focusing on the pivotal era of the American Revolution and the early years of the American Republic, the work provides an in-depth look at the strategic alliances, official correspondence, and personal interactions that shaped modern history. By presenting these archival documents, the volume offers readers a direct window into the military cooperation and political negotiations that proved crucial to American independence. This collection serves as an indispensable resource for historians and researchers interested in the nuances of international diplomacy and the enduring impact of French influence on the foundational years of the United States. Through its meticulous documentation, the work highlights the intellectual and political exchanges that defined a transformative period in global history, making it a vital addition to the study of Franco-American heritage.
